Common Pest Control Problems in Morrow
Living in Morrow means dealing with pest pressures that are distinctly shaped by Clayton County's warm, humid climate and suburban landscape. Residents throughout this area encounter recurring infestations that worsen with Georgia's long summers and mild winters, which allow pest populations to remain active nearly year-round.
Ants represent one of the most persistent complaints. Argentine ants and odorous house ants form massive colonies that trail through kitchen cabinets, bathrooms, and along exterior foundation walls. During spring swarms, carpenter ants become especially concerning for homeowners with mature trees or wooden structures near Lake Harbin and the surrounding neighborhoods.
Termites pose a serious threat to Morrow properties. The combination of clay-rich soil and abundant moisture creates ideal conditions for subterranean termites. These destructive pests often work undetected for years, compromising floor joists, wall studs, and structural supports before visible damage appears.
Mosquitoes flourish near standing water sources throughout the area, including backyard ponds, clogged gutters, and drainage ditches. Beyond the nuisance of bites, these insects carry health risks that concern families with children and outdoor pets. Meanwhile, rodents exploit gaps in older homes near downtown Morrow and newer construction alike, seeking shelter as temperatures drop.
Roaches, spiders, and stinging insects round out the typical pest pressures. American and smokybrown cockroaches thrive in the humidity, while brown recluse and black widow spiders establish themselves in undisturbed storage areas. Paper wasps and yellow jackets build nests under eaves, in shrubs, and occasionally within wall voids.

Pest Control Pricing in the Morrow Area
Service costs in Morrow reflect property size, pest type, infestation severity, and treatment frequency. Understanding typical pricing ranges helps homeowners budget appropriately and recognize value in professional protection.
General pest control for average-sized single-family homes typically runs between $89-$150 for initial treatments, with quarterly maintenance plans ranging from $39-$79 per visit. These recurring programs prove most economical over time, preventing the costly damage and repeated emergency calls that result from neglected infestations.
Termite protection represents a larger but essential investment. Liquid barrier treatments generally cost $800-$2,000 depending on linear footage and soil conditions, while baiting systems range from $1,000-$2,500 with annual monitoring fees. Given that termite damage often exceeds $3,000-$5,000 in repair costs when left untreated, proactive treatment delivers substantial long-term savings.
Mosquito reduction programs during peak season (March through October) typically cost $69-$129 per monthly treatment for standard residential lots. Rodent control starts around $150-$300 for initial service with follow-up visits as needed.
